Jan 5, 2024 · The typical punishment for keying a car as a misdemeanor offense includes fines ranging from a few hundred to several thousand dollars. Probation may be imposed, requiring the offender to regularly report to a probation officer. Community service may be ordered, where the offender must perform unpaid work for a specified number of hours. On a typical car, a clear coat scratch can cost anywhere from $100 to $400 to fix. However, if the scratch is deep and goes beyond the base coat, it can easily cost you $500 to $2000. If you have an exotic car, you may have to pay a fortune to repair even a little scratch, which is why these cars cost more to insure.

Mar 11, 2023 · Car keying is a malicious act where a person uses a sharp object to scratch the surface of a car’s paint. This act may seem harmless, but it can have a significant impact on car owners. Car keying can be a costly repair, with paint jobs ranging from hundreds to thousands of dollars.
